This task will track the racking, setup, and OS installation of cp501[3-6]
== Hostname / Racking / Installation Details ==
**Hostnames:** cp5013, cp5014, cp5015, cp5016
**Racking Proposal:** Same split as rest of cluster: odd-numbered hosts in rack 603 and even-numbered hosts in rack 604
**Networking/Subnet/VLAN/IP:** Onboard 1GbE disabled, use 1x 10G port from add-in card connected to top-of-rack switch, to vlan private1-eqsin (520)
**Partitioning/Raid:** Partman has a recipe for this config already, but we will have to add a new line to netboot.cfg for the two different kinds of hardware now in eqsin
**OS Distro:** Buster
